Communist insurgency in Thailand

Date 1965–1983 (18 years)
Location Thailand (primarily northeast Thailand)
Result Thai government victory Amnesty declared on 23 April 1980 by the Thai government Order 66/2523 signed by Prime Minister Prem Tinsulanonda Communist insurgency declines and ends in 1983

Was Thailand ever a Communist?

The Communist Party of Thailand (Abrv: CPT; Thai: พรรคคอมมิวนิสต์แห่งประเทศไทย, RTGS: phak khommionit haeng prathet thai) was a communist party in Thailand active from 1942 until the 1990s. The party launched a guerrilla war against the Thai government in 1965.

Is Thailand a monarchy or dictatorship?

Thailand categorizes itself as a constitutional monarchy, the king has little direct power under the constitution and exercises power through the National Assembly, the Council of Ministers, and the Courts in accordance with the 2017 constitution.
